Heteroaryl halides undergoes cross-couplings with alkynes in good yields in the presence of [PdCl (C3H5)] 2/cis, cis, cis-1, 2, 3, 4-tetrakis (diphenylphosphinomethyl) cyclopentane as catalyst. A variety of heteroaryl halides such as pyridines, quinolines, a pyrimidine, an indole, a thiophene, or a thiazole have been used successfully.
